Choosing the Best 3D Printing Service Bureau in the UK

3D printing has revolutionized manufacturing, making it easier, faster, and more affordable to produce complex and customized parts. However, not all businesses have the resources, expertise, or equipment to perform 3D printing in-house. That's where 3D printing service bureaus come in. They offer a variety of 3D printing technologies, materials, and services to help businesses and individuals bring their designs to life. In this blog post, we'll explore how to choose the best 3D printing service bureau in the UK.

Step 1: Define Your Requirements

Before you start looking for a 3D printing service bureau in the UK, you need to know what you want to achieve. Ask yourself these questions:

What is the purpose of the parts you want to print?

What are the technical specifications of the parts (e.g. size, shape, tolerance, resolution, accuracy)?

What is the quantity that you need?

What is the expected turnaround time?

What is your budget?

Having clear answers to these questions will help you choose the most suitable 3D printing technology, material, and service. For example, if you need high-resolution, small-sized parts with tight tolerances, stereolithography (SLA) may be the best option, while if you need large-sized, functional parts with high durability, fused deposition modeling (FDM) may be more appropriate.

Step 2: Research 3D Printing Service Bureaus

With your requirements in mind, you can start looking for 3D printing service bureaus in the UK. Here are some ways to do that:

Google search: Use keywords such as "3D printing service bureau UK" or "3D printing company UK" to find websites of potential service providers.

Business directories: Check out online directories such as 3D Hubs, Sculpteo, or MakeXYZ that list 3D printing service bureaus based on location, technology, or rating.

Industry events: Attend local or national trade shows, conferences, or exhibitions where 3D printing service bureaus showcase their products and services.

Step 3: Evaluate 3D Printing Service Bureaus

Once you have a list of potential 3D printing service bureaus in the UK, you need to evaluate them based on the following factors:

Technology: Does the service bureau offer the 3D printing technology that you need? Is the technology up-to-date and reliable?

Material: Does the service bureau offer the 3D printing material that you need? Is the material of high quality and consistent?

Service: Does the service bureau offer the 3D printing service that you need? Is the service professional, responsive, and flexible?

Price: Is the price of the 3D printing service competitive and transparent? Are there any hidden costs or fees?

Quality: Does the service bureau have a reputation for delivering high-quality parts with minimal errors or defects? Do they offer any quality assurance or quality control measures?

Based on these criteria, you can shortlist a few 3D printing service bureaus that meet your requirements and contact them for further information, quotes, or samples.

Step 4: Collaborate with 3D Printing Service Bureaus

Once you have chosen a 3D printing service bureau in the UK, you need to establish a collaboration that ensures smooth and efficient production. Here are some tips to achieve that:

Communicate clearly and often: Provide detailed and accurate instructions, drawings, or models to the service bureau and keep them updated on any changes or issues. Ask for regular progress reports, photos, or videos to monitor the production.

Test and validate: Ask for samples or prototypes before mass production to test and validate the parts. This can help you detect potential flaws or limitations early on and avoid costly mistakes.

Provide feedback: Give constructive feedback to the service bureau on their performance, quality, and service. This can help them improve and deliver better results in the future.

By following these steps, you can choose the best 3D printing service bureau in the UK that meets your needs, expectations, and budget. Whether you need prototypes, spare parts, tooling, or end-use products, a reliable and professional 3D printing service bureau can help you turn your ideas into reality.

3D printing materials

Plastics

One of the most commonly used 3D printing materials. These materials include ABS, PLA, PETG, TPU, PEEK, etc. Each material has different physical and chemical properties and can be suitable for different application scenarios.

Metal

Metal 3D printing materials include titanium alloy, aluminum alloy, stainless steel, nickel alloy, etc. Metal 3D printing can produce complex components and molds, with advantages such as high strength and high wear resistance.

Ceramic

Ceramic 3D printing materials include alumina, zirconia, silicate, etc. Ceramic 3D printing can produce high-precision ceramic products, such as ceramic parts, ceramic sculptures, etc.

3D Printing FAQs

Poor printing quality may be caused by improper printer adjustment, material issues, or design issues. The solution includes adjusting printer settings, replacing materials, or redesigning the model.

The printing speed may be slow due to issues with the mechanical structure or control system of the printer. The solution includes upgrading printer hardware or adjusting printer settings

Possible poor adhesion of the printing bed due to surface or material issues. The solution includes replacing the surface of the printing bed, using a bottom coating, or replacing materials.

The printer may malfunction due to hardware or software issues. The solution includes checking and repairing printer hardware, updating printer software, or reinstalling drivers.
